TERM 3 KEY EVENTS Date| Event 26 September 2026| Price Giving Day & Anniversary Celebration 29 October – 3 November 2026| Term Break / Exit 31 October 2026| Form 4 & Form 6 Visiting Day 15 – 27 November 2026| Examinations – Non-ZIMSEC Classes Price Giving Day & Anniversary — 26 September The school will come together on 26 September 2026 for the Price Giving Day and Anniversary Celebration. This will be an opportunity to recognise and celebrate learners who have demonstrated outstanding academic performance and excellence in various areas. Parents, guardians and members of the school community are encouraged to join us as we celebrate our learners' achievements. Term Break / Exit — 29 October to 3 November Learners will proceed for their Term Break/Exit from 29 October to 3 November 2026. Parents and guardians are encouraged to take note of these dates and make the necessary arrangements. Form 4 & Form 6 Visiting Day — 31 October A special Visiting Day for Form 4 and Form 6 learners will be held on 31 October 2026. Parents and guardians are encouraged to use this opportunity to engage with and encourage learners as they continue preparing for their examinations. Examinations — 15 to 27 November The Non-ZIMSEC examinations will take place from 15 to 27 November 2026. Learners are encouraged to begin their preparations early, attend lessons consistently and seek assistance from their teachers where necessary.
